101 65th Ave Meridian MS, 39307
💨 Air Quality 1.72%
Sector
Energy
Sub-sector
Integrated Oil & Gas
⭐️ Overall Rating 24.27%
💦 Water Quality 40.30%
Follow the money flow of climate, technology, and energy investments to uncover new opportunities and jobs.